Bolter is a start-up law firm brought to life by Clifford Gouldson Lawyers and led by Ben Gouldson.

In this podcast, a session in our ReinventED Legal Business: The Case Studies seriesTerri Mottershead, Executive Director, Centre for Legal Innovation (Australia, New Zealand and Asia-Pacific) chatted with Ben about:

  • The variety of solutions and pricing structures the firm offers to help navigate the maze of forms, contracts and questions that new businesses encounter when they are starting out
  • How the Bolter team applies its understanding of the unique challenges of building a start-up or small business from the ground up, to provide a better way for clients to engage with lawyers
  • The advantages and disadvantages of establishing a disruptive business unit or initiative in a law firm
  • If it is possible for work to flow from a more traditional practice to a disruptive business entity and vice versa
  • The importance of experimentation, continuous improvement, listening, an open mindset, encouraging and including different thinking, and being future focused in legal transformation
  • How more traditional law firms can expand the lessons learned from their disruptive businesses to transform all aspects of all businesses
